Georgina Evans primarily focuses on contemporary French film, with a particular interest in inter-sensory relationships in cinema and the workings of synaesthetic narrative. Her published works include analyses of French films by notable directors such as Michael Haneke and Krzysztof Kieslowski, with a specific emphasis on the works of Claire Denis. Additionally, Evans is involved in a project that examines the concept of home within French cinema.
